Brief summary
The objective of the current study is to investigate the efficacy, safety and tolerability of BI 1356 (5 mg once daily) compared to placebo given for 24 weeks as add-on therapy to metformin in combination with a sulphonylurea in patients with type 2 diabetes mellitus with insufficient glycaemic control.

Eligibility
Inclusion criteria
1. Male and female patients with a diagnosis of type 2 diabetes mellitus, currently treated only with a stable total daily dose of preferably\* \>/= 1500 mg metformin and a dose of a sulphonylurea drug that has been documented, by the Investigator, to be the individual maximum tolerated dose of that sulphonylurea drug. Both the dose and dosing regimen of metformin and the sulphonylurea must be stable (i.e. unchanged) for 10 weeks prior to informed consent, and must not be changed for the duration of the trial 2. Glycosylated haemoglobin A1 (HbA1c) \>/= 7.0 and \</= 10.0% at the screening Visit 1a and at Visit 2 (start of placebo run-in phase) 3. Age \>/= 18 and \</= 80 years at Visit 1a (screening) 4. BMI (Body Mass Index) \</= 40 kg/m2 at Visit 1a (screening) 5. Signed and dated written informed consent, at the latest by the date of Visit 1a, in accordance with GCP and local legislation \*Patients currently treated with a total daily dose of less than 1500 mg metformin can be included in the trial if the Investigator has documented that the dose is the maximum tolerated dose of metformin for that patient.
Exclusion criteria
1. Myocardial infarction, stroke or TIA (transient ischaemic attack) within 6 months prior to the date of informed consent 2. Impaired hepatic function, defined by serum levels of either alanine transaminase (ALT/SGPT), aspartase transaminase (AST/SGOT), or alkaline phosphatase (ALP) above 3 times the upper limit of normal (ULN), as determined at Visit 1a 3. Renal failure or renal impairment (serum creatinine \>/= 1.5 mg/dl) as determined at Visit 1a 4. Treatment with rosiglitazone or pioglitazone within 3 months prior to the date of informed consent 5. Treatment with GLP-1 analogues (e.g. exenatide) within 3 months prior to the date of informed consent 6. Treatment with insulin within 3 months prior to the date of informed consent 7. Treatment with anti-obesity drugs (e.g. sibutramine, rimonabant, orlistat) within 3 months prior to the date of informed consent 8. Current treatment with systemic steroids (i.e. at the time of informed consent) or a change in the dosage of thyroid hormones within 6 weeks prior to the date of informed consent 9. Pre-menopausal women (last menstruation \</= 1 year prior to the date of informed consent) who: * are nursing or pregnant * or are of child-bearing potential and are not practicing an acceptable method of birth control, or do not plan to continue using this method throughout the study and do not agree to periodic pregnancy testing during their participation in the trial. Acceptable methods of birth control include transdermal patch, intra uterine devices/systems (IUDs/IUSs), oral, implantable or injectable contraceptives, sexual abstinence and vasectomised partner. No exception will be made. 10. Known hypersensitivity or allergy to the investigational product or its excipients or to the trial background therapy (i.e. metformin in combination with a sulphonylurea) or sulphonamides 11. Dehydration (as confirmed by the Investigators clinical opinion) 12. Current acute or chronic metabolic acidosis

Participant flow
Participants by arm
| Arm | Count |
|---|---|
| Placebo Patients randomized to receive treatment with matching placebo | 263 |
| Linagliptin Patients randomized to receive treatment with Linagliptin 5mg | 792 |
| Total | 1,055 |

Outcome results
HbA1c Change From Baseline to Week 24
HbA1c is measured as a percentage. Thus, this change from baseline reflects the Week 24 HbA1c percent minus the baseline HbA1c percent. Means are treatment adjusted for baseline HbA1c and previous anti-diabetic medication.
Time frame: Baseline and week 24
Population: The Full Analysis Set (FAS) included all treated and randomised patients with a baseline and at least one on treatment HbA1c measurement available. Last observation carried forward (LOCF) was used as the imputation rule.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Placebo | HbA1c Change From Baseline to Week 24 | -0.10 Percent | Standard Error 0.05 |
| Linagliptin | HbA1c Change From Baseline to Week 24 | -0.72 Percent | Standard Error 0.03 |
FPG Change From Baseline to Week 12
This change from baseline reflects the Week 12 FPG minus the baseline FPG. Means are treatment adjusted for baseline HbA1c, baseline FPG and previous anti-diabetic medication.
Time frame: Baseline and week 12
Population: This population includes the FAS using the LOCF imputation, with the further restriction of patients with a baseline and post-baseline FPG value.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Placebo | FPG Change From Baseline to Week 12 | 6.2 mg/dL | Standard Error 2 |
| Linagliptin | FPG Change From Baseline to Week 12 | -9.5 mg/dL | Standard Error 1.2 |
